Transaction 58eedcf83ea730e369dde36df1c9e9c4b8362fe53cdca37442ba9b7d5e71c806
1 Input
1 Output
-
58eedcf83ea730e369dde36df1c9e9c4b8362fe53cdca37442ba9b7d5e71c806:0
- value
- 593696
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 909ed639547f476448139348d84e43e81399fcea58d01978aecc2ac9ab42251b
- address
- bc1pjz0dvw250arkgjqnjdydsnjraqfenl82trgpj79wes4vn26zy5dsy2ffue